For many years, long before our current financial crises, our firm has adopted the mission statement “To help our clients achieve financial peace of mind.” Never before has this been more challenging than the last several months. As we entered 2009, we adopted the motto, “Let’s look forward, not back.” Fortunately the past three months have provided a strong rebound in the stock market, with US Large Company stocks up over 25% and most stock asset classes (especially international stocks, but not REIT’s) actually showing gains for the year. Only time will tell whether we will have a recovery in the form of a “V”, “W” or “U” but we continue to be confident that we will have a recovery and that the investment return potential in the 2010 to 2012 time period should be good.
